Costs & Logistics
The program costs vary from year to year depending on number of students enrolled, exchange rates, and logistical cost changes. The ESTIMATED program fee for Summer 2025 has not been determined at this time. The Program fee for May 2025 was $3625 (this includes a $300 security deposit paid upon acceptance to the program). This amount is only an estimate and is subject to change until all students are accepted to the program in the Spring.
In addition to the program fee, students are expected to pay 3 hours of in-state tuition and UGA Mandatory Fees through their Athena student accounts after registration. The HOPE and Zell Miller scholarships can be applied towards TUITION only if applicable. **non-UGA transient students may have an additional $250 fee upon registration**
The program fee listed above includes the following:
- Fully-furnished shared apartments in central Prague
- Educational and cultural activities and adventures
- All program-related transportation
- Overnight trip to Cesky Krumlov
- Travel Health Insurance through UGA
- A welcome dinner, and a closing dinner
- Transit pass for trams, buses, subways
- A dedicated classroom with WiFi access
- and so much more!
The program fee listed above does not include:
- 3 hours of in-state tuition and UGA Mandatory fees (See UGA’s website for updated tuition and fees rates for 2025)
- International airfare (Typically around $1,200 – $1,500)
- Meals other than the welcome and closing dinners
- Books – if applicable
- Personal purchases and weekend travel
- International data plan for your U.S. cell phone. This is a requirement.
- Passport cost if the student does not have one already
- Miscellaneous expenses
